Firm Overview

FT Partners is one of the most successful boutique investment banks on Wall Street. Headquartered in San Francisco with offices in NYC and London, FT Partners has advised on some of the most significant transactions in the Financial Technology (“FinTech”) sector.  FT Partners offer a full suite of financial and strategic advisory services, including M&A advisory, private capital raising and capital markets advisory. The FinTech sector is a dynamic industry that encompasses the convergence of financial services and technology. FT Partners is a 250+ banker global firm that prides itself on having an extremely collegial and energetic culture.

Role Description

The Special Executions Group (“SpecialX”) brings a differentiated level of execution rigor and depth. Comprised of bankers with specialized financial and data analytics capabilities, SpecialX centralizes FT Partners’ quantitative expertise, ensuring formidable execution success for all our clients. We are seeking analysts for two teams within SpecialX:

  • Core SpecialX team members work alongside investment bankers & clients to provide leadership and support across all quantitative areas, including modeling excellence, growth initiative validation, key KPI analysis, and broad financial strategy across deals.
  • SpecialX data analysts work with investment bankers & clients by leveraging sophisticated tools to analyze complex data sets and present critical analyses in support of core investment theses and growth initiatives.

As a government contractor subject to the Vietnam Era Veterans Readjustment Assistance Act (VEVRAA), we request this information in order to measure the effectiveness of the outreach and positive recruitment efforts we undertake pursuant to VEVRAA. Classification of protected categories is as follows:

A "disabled veteran" is one of the following: a veteran of the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service who is entitled to compensation (or who but for the receipt of military retired pay would be entitled to compensation) under laws administered by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s; or a person who was discharged or released from active duty because of a service-connected disability.

A "recently separated veteran" means any veteran during the three-year period beginning on the date of such veteran's discharge or release from active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val, or air service.

An "active duty wartime or campaign badge veteran" means a veteran who served on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service during a war, or in a campaign or expedition for which a campaign badge has been authorized under the laws administered by the Department of Defense.

An "Armed forces service medal veteran" means a veteran who, while serving on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service, participated in a United States military operation for which an Armed Forces service medal was awarded pursuant to Executive Order 12985.

Why are you being asked to complete this form?

We are a federal contractor or subcontractor. The law requires us to provide equal employment opportunity to qualified people with disabilities. We have a goal of having at least 7% of our workers as people with disabilities. The law says we must measure our progress towards this goal. To do this, we must ask applicants and employees if they have a disability or have ever had one. People can become disabled, so we need to ask this question at least every five years.

Completing this form is voluntary, and we hope that you will choose to do so. Your answer is confidential. No one who makes hiring decisions will see it. Your decision to complete the form and your answer will not harm you in any way. If you want to learn more about the law or this form, visit the U.S. Department of Labor’s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(OFCCP) website at www.dol.gov/ofccp.
